出 处:《中国全科医学》2018年第6期648-653,共6页Chinese General Practice
摘 要:目的利用静息态功能连接方法,探讨女性抑郁障碍患者默认网络相关脑区脑功能连接变化。方法选取2013年1月—2014年9月北京大学第六医院门诊和住院的女性抑郁障碍患者为病例组(n=27)。同期按照与病例组患者性别、年龄、受教育年限匹配原则从北京大学医学部社区居民及北京大学第六医院职工家属中招募健康者作为正常对照组(n=37)。受试者均进行静息态功能性磁共振成像(rs-f MRI)扫描。以左侧楔前叶和左侧顶下小叶为感兴趣区(ROI),通过ROI与全脑的功能连接分析,比较两组默认网络相关脑区脑功能连接差异。结果与正常对照组比较,病例组左侧顶下小叶与右侧扣带回功能连接增加,左侧楔前叶与右侧丘脑及双侧中脑功能连接增加(P<0.05,Alphasim校正)。结论女性抑郁障碍患者静息态下默认网络相关的脑区与多个脑网络功能连接存在异常,这些异常可能参与了其神经病理学发病机制。Objective To explore the functional connectivities of default-mode network related brain regions in female patients with depression by using resting-state functional magnetic resonance imaging(rs-fMRI).Methods Twentyseven female patients(outpatients and inpatients of Peking University Sixth Hospital)with depression were enrolled as the case group from January 2013 to September 2014.In the same period,37 age-and education-matched healthy females were enrolled as the control group from residents of communities surrounding Peking University Health Science Center and the families of the staff of Peking University Sixth Hospital.All subjects received rs-fMRI scanning.The left precuneus and the left inferior parietal lobule were selected as the two regions of interest(ROI).We used voxel-based correlation analyses to measure functional connectivities in the ROI in both groups,and compared the functional connectivity differences of the default-mode network related brain regions between the two groups.Results Compared with the control group,the case group showed significantly increased functional connectivity(P<0.05,corrected by Alphasim)between the left inferior parietal lobule and the right cingulate cortex,and between the left precuneus and both the right thalamus and the bilateral midbrain.Conclusion The results suggest that abnormal functional connectivities between default-mode network related brain regions and multiple brain networks existed in depressed female patients during the resting state.These abnormalities may play a role in the pathogenesis of depression in these patients.
